Doing research in challenging scientific fields is what I am interested in. I have developed my research and personal skills by doing a PhD at University of Twente. Currently I am an assistant professor at Delft University of technology. I am experienced in membrane separation technology for water treatment as well as gas separation. I also have experience in multiphase flow in porous media, gas-liquid membrane contactors, microlfuidics design and experiments. I am a responsible and determined researcher who is open to new challenges.
Onderzoeksinteresses
1- Smart and stimuli-responsive membranes
2- Advanced separation-sensing microfluidic devices
3- Interface science and wetting properties of surfaces
4- Ion exchange membranes
5- Bio-based membranes for gas separation
6- Oily waste water treatment using membrane technology
7- Bio-fouling of membranes
8- Gas-liquid membrane contactors
9- Acoustophoresis and Electrophoresis
10- Two-phase flow and immiscible displacement in porous media
